What’s the most fun way to exercise?

We gave in and got an indoor bike for exercising. The problem is, winter in Canada lasts practically six months. You need to have options to work out at home. As a consequence I started paying attention to my health and exercising more this year. I’m really happy with the results. It has improved my health, my mood, and my general disposition. But I wouldn’t be doing this so often if it wasn’t fun. Just sitting in a bike without any entertainment isn’t inviting. So, I have been taking the classes that our fitness app suggests. It truly helps!

Virtual classes

I will admit that the modern world is helping me getting more things done in less time. If it depended only on me, I would probably lack the discipline to exercise every day. I need someone to push me. And I never had a personal trainer, but I understand why we need them. It is easier to finish the exercise if you have someone giving you commands. They might even tease you or say encouraging words. An upbeat playlist definitely helps. I still don’t have a personal trainer, but the instructor in the virtual class does that job very well. By now I know the instructors I like the most. Occasionally, I try someone new. I do this just to see what I might be missing.

Reading a book

When I’m more introspective, I read a book during my bike hour. I’m almost finishing now The Secret History by Donna Tart. While exercising I listen to the audiobook and read the e-book at the same time on the bike’s screen. I try to do the intervals alternating cadence and resistance that I learned on the classes. It’s not bad.

Adding variety

I started only with the bike and stretching, and was initially satisfied with it. Then I started adding other light exercises like yoga, Pilates and meditation. The next step was to lift some light weights. I focused on the upper body one day. I concentrated on the lower body the next day. Finally, I targeted the full body on yet another day. It’s like food, you don’t want to eat the same thing everyday, so adding variety helps get me going.

Getting the indoor bike was a good investment. It helps me exercise while having fun.
